**Action item (P2):** The Broadmere diff viewer choked on a 900 MB generated file and pinned a render worker for six minutes. Fix is to cap parse size and chunk the hunks — please sanity-check that the caps can't be bypassed via crafted headers. Current proposed limits are as follows.

tuning table, yajog-yahof:
BUDGETS = {
    "lamvan": 303,
    "wenox": 460,
    "fenvan": 525,
}

ALERT: The static-analysis baseline file for the Quillgate repository has changed outside the approved review flow. The baseline (suppressions for the Ferrohawk scanner) was modified in a direct push, bypassing the required two-reviewer policy. This may mask newly suppressed findings, including injection-class rules. Please diff the baseline against the last signed revision, verify each added suppression has a linked justification, and confirm no high-severity rules were silenced. Questions about the signing process go to the address below.

escalation mailbox, kahog-bafog: ralwyn_quenael@zemvarsys.corp

Release checklist — Shorelark tide-table widget, security review. Confirm the widget fetches tide data only over the pinned channel and rejects unsigned payloads from the Brinemoor upstream. Verify the embedded renderer sanitizes station names before display, since these are user-influenced upstream. Check that the offline cache is scoped per-origin and expires within 48 hours. No third-party scripts should load at runtime; the bundle audit must show zero external references. The signed bundle's attestation token is recorded on the next line.

session token of tajef-bageg = htk21_5d90d574934f3ccae6437

Ticket #4482 — Vault lockout blocking contrast audit. The Huebright accessibility team can't open the Lintfall vault that stores our color-contrast audit tokens, so the WCAG report for the Peridot dashboard is stalled. Vault auto-locked after three failed attempts by the audit runner. For the weekly sync: unlock is approved by Marisol, ops lead. The recovery passphrase is as follows.

strongbox words: norwyn-wenael-aldvan-aldiel-wendor-holael